CISPR-25 Summary

At 3.3V, the LMK3C0105-Q1 with no shielding vias and 8+ in trace length passes Class 5 standards for all bands except for TV Band IV, Analouge UHF, GPS L1, and GPS L5. For best performance, use of additional GND vias and SSC is recommended.

At 1.8V, the LMK3C0105-Q1 with no shielding vias and 8+ in trace length passes Class 5 standards for all bands except for TV Band IV, GPS L1, and GPS L5. For best performance, use of additional GND vias or SSC is highly recommended.

Table 3-2 Board Variation Summary Table
Board Variant Device Trace Routing Shielding Vias Clock Layer Trace Length
1 LMK3C0105-Q1 Immediate Termination No L1 66mil
2 LMK3C0105-Q1 Immediate Branch Out Yes (400mil spaced array) L6 9 - 12in
3 LMK3C0105-Q1 Immediate Branch Out No L6 9 - 12in
4 Competitor Oscillator Immediate Termination No L1 66mil
